Just as Leo is about to bring a dark cloud to Ben’s life, Jim arrives and rescues him. This simple gesture leads to them reconnecting once again ang being comfortable to each other. Ben begins to hope for him and Jim to take everything to the next level. And then... the girlfriend arrives. (Source: Regal Entertainment, Inc. Youtube Channel)

Ben X Jim (2020) Episode 3: Getting Close

I enjoyed Episode 3: Getting Close and I'm really starting to like the characters of Ben and Jim. I appreciated that both Ben and Jim were self-aware of their flaws. On Jim's part for example, he said "I am not as woke as you." Ben and Jim haven't seen each other for a long time but listening to their conversations with each other and seeing their glances to each other, one just know that they have a powerful bond rooted in a strong friendship. The way shirtless Jim looked at shirtless Ben (both guys looked hot by the way, lol), you'd wonder if there's something there that's more than friendship. Teejay and Jerome have chemistry together. They shared heartfelt and hilarious lines. But Teejay and Ron also looked good together. Ben and Olan's exchanges were funny and naughty. I don't mind if in the end, Ben and Olan end up together. We don't always get the happy ending we want. Sometimes, we get the happy ending we need. There were no awkward dialogues. Screenplay was even able to seamlessly incorporate the characteristics of Filipino (Pinoy) superheroes Captain Barbel and Darna and the struggles of Pinoy modern-day heroes like our frontliners (small business owners, essential workers, couriers, etc.). Acting was consistently good. Audio-visuals were mostly satisfactory. Overall, this was quite a good episode.
